Commodity charges <br /> will be reviewed no less frequently than every two years and <br /> adjusted, as needed, effective with the mid-March master meter <br /> reading of year of adjustment. The commodity charge shall <br /> include a rate multiplier (based on the sum of both demand and <br /> commodity charges) of 1.20. There shall be no rate multiplier for <br /> filtration. At any time during the term of this agreement the <br /> District may change from a rate multiplier charge to a connection <br /> fee charge based on the mutual agreement and execution by <br /> both the District and the City. <br /> 3. Any increase in or additional excise, utility or other taxes <br /> imposed by the federal, state, or other governmental agency, <br /> including such taxes which may be imposed upon the water and <br /> filtration utility by the Everett City Council, shall be borne by all <br /> classes of users of the City's water, including the District to <br /> whom such tax may be applicable, in proportion to the total <br /> revenues received from such users. <br /> B. Rates for Filtration <br /> 1. In addition to water rates discussed above, the District agrees to <br /> pay for cost of filtering water in accordance with the following <br /> formula: <br /> R = P (M + C + DS + FDS + O) <br /> X Q <br /> R = Additional cost for filtered water— (to be added to <br /> current water rate) computed to nearest ten- <br /> thousandth of a Dollar per 100 cubic feet. <br /> M = Maintenance & Operation cost for Lake Chaplain <br /> Filtration plant for preceding year less any credit from <br /> the sinking fund. <br /> C = Additional Capital Outlay costs attributable to <br /> Filtration plant for preceding year, less funds <br /> collected and used from the sinking fund.
